Output de932078484349e5663a4d3f771f5d22ea36df3d1291b7c02ffc55314419955c:2

value
75000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ba7c81aa2ff9103384fcf9fd791113218aeb9f1 OP_EQUAL
address
32keMKxontMxuxud1ERkJQR19Xa6MpE73d
transaction
de932078484349e5663a4d3f771f5d22ea36df3d1291b7c02ffc55314419955c
spent
true